Deputy FM: Armenia values Iran’s stance on territorial integrity
Armenian Deputy Foreign Minister Vahan Kostanyan, during an official visit to Tehran, emphasised that Yerevan takes into account Iran’s vital interests when shaping its foreign policy decisions.
Kostanyan met with several senior Iranian officials, including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i and Presidential Advisor on Political Affairs Mehdi Sanaei, Caliber.Az reports, citing Armenian media.
“Yerevan attaches great importance to Iran’s consistent and public stance on the necessity of unconditional respect for territorial integrity, sovereignty, and the inviolability of national borders. Armenia, in turn, takes into consideration Iran’s vital interests,” Kostanyan stated.
He expressed high appreciation for Tehran’s support regarding the initialling of the agreement “On the Establishment of Peace and Inter-State Relations between Armenia and Azerbaijan,” as well as its backing of the broader normalisation process between the two countries aimed at securing lasting regional peace.
Kostanyan emphasised that the unblocking of economic communications in the region must be carried out on the basis of reciprocity and jurisdiction, in accordance with the provisions outlined in the declaration on the normalisation of relations between Armenia and Azerbaijan.
At the conclusion of the talks, both sides agreed to maintain regular dialogue on pressing issues on the bilateral agenda.
